diff --git a/gradle/ide.gradle b/gradle/ide.gradle index d5215f2875f..fc3d07afc7d 100644 --- a/gradle/ide.gradle +++ b/gradle/ide.gradle @@ -72,6 +72,7 @@ eclipse.classpath.file.whenMerged { // Include project specific settings task eclipseSettings(type: Copy) { from rootProject.files( + 'src/eclipse/org.eclipse.core.resources.prefs', 'src/eclipse/org.eclipse.jdt.core.prefs', 'src/eclipse/org.eclipse.jdt.ui.prefs') into project.file('.settings/') @@ -79,6 +80,7 @@ task eclipseSettings(type: Copy) { } task cleanEclipseSettings(type: Delete) { + delete project.file('.settings/org.eclipse.core.resources.prefs') delete project.file('.settings/org.eclipse.jdt.core.prefs') delete project.file('.settings/org.eclipse.jdt.ui.prefs') } diff --git a/src/eclipse/org.eclipse.core.resources.prefs b/src/eclipse/org.eclipse.core.resources.prefs new file mode 100644 index 00000000000..99f26c0203a --- /dev/null +++ b/src/eclipse/org.eclipse.core.resources.prefs @@ -0,0 +1,2 @@ +eclipse.preferences.version=1 +encoding/=UTF-8